Welcome to the World Golf Hall of Fame online Solheim Cup exhibit, provided to give you a taste of what's inside the museum's latest exhibition. With the support of PING, LPGA and the Ladies European Tour, the World Golf Hall of Fame opened an exhibit on August 17 that tells the story of women’s professional golf’s most prestigious team competition, The Solheim Cup. The exhibit is titled “Pride, Passion, Patriotism: A Celebration of The Solheim Cup” and will run through December 2007. The exhibit features many stories as told by Solheim Cup captains and participants themselves, as well as personal memorabilia to support those stories. On display from the Solheim family is one of three original Solheim Cup trophies. Photos, video and additional memorabilia are included in the display through a variety of sources, including Hall of Fame members, the LPGA, Ladies European Tour and PING. And, LIZGOLF and Abacus, the official apparel providers for the 2007 U.S. and European teams, respectively, have each provided an outfit that will be worn during the 2007 event. “Pride, Passion, Patriotism: A Celebration of The Solheim Cup” also looks at the fans who have poured their hearts out through face-painting, serenading and chanting as they’ve rooted on their country. And, since the inaugural event, the U.S. and European team captains have risen to the challenge of shepherding their players through this emotionally-driven team competition. The exhibition recognizes the numerous attributes the past captains have had—many whom are Hall of Fame members—as well as reveal some of their unique and personal tactics they have used to build a cohesive team.
